Tullahought
Tullahought is a small village and townland in south County Kilkenny, Ireland. It is located approximately 8 miles north of Carrick on Suir and 25 miles south of Kilkenny City.Photo: Tronixbox,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Knockroe Passage Tomb
Archaeological site

Knockroe Passage Tomb is a prehistoric site, of the Neolithic period, in the townland of Knockroe in County Kilkenny, Ireland, about 10 km north of Carrick-on-Suir. Knockroe Passage Tomb is situated 3 km northwest of Tullahought.

Kilmaganny
Village

Kilmoganny is a small village in the County Kilkenny in the south-east of Ireland. Saint Mogeanna was an Irish virgin whose feast day in the Irish Calendar of Saints is 29 January. Kilmaganny is situated 5 km northeast of Tullahought.
Windgap
Village

Windgap, is a village in County Kilkenny, in Ireland. Windgap is located in the south-western part of Kilkenny on the border with Tipperary, just south of Callan. Windgap is situated 5 km northwest of Tullahought.
Hugginstown
Village

Hugginstown is a small village and townland in south County Kilkenny, Ireland. The local Gaelic Athletic Association club, Carrickshock GAA, play their home games in the village. Hugginstown is situated 8 km northeast of Tullahought.
